Afghanistan increased exports by rail

29 Aug 2024 - 13:19

The Ministry of Public Works announced that over 316,000 tons of goods were exported via railways during the month of August.


Afghan Voice Agency (AVA) - Monitoring: According to the ministry’s report, from the beginning to the end of August, a total of 316,743 tons of goods were transported abroad using Afghanistan’s railway lines.
Specifically, 255,307 tons of goods were exported from Hairatan port, 27,831 tons from Aqina port, 29,029 tons from Torghundi, and 4,576 tons via the Khaf-Herat railway line. These exports included both oil and non-oil products.
The ministry has encouraged national traders to consider using the railway system for a secure, cost-effective, and efficient method of transporting commercial goods.
